Recently, Opel Insignia has undergone various modifications. After his restyling the brand has been renewed some engines. The 2.0 CDTi 170 horsepower was recently updated and now diesel engines are more modest range which are modified to meet the Euro 6 emission standards.
The largest model of Opel now implemented in its range the new engine 1.6 CDTi already present in almost all models of the brand. This diesel engine reaches levels horses 120 and 136 power and replaces two versions of 2.0 CDTI hitherto marketed. The least powerful is a replacement for the 2.0 CDTi 120 hp. Equipped with manual six relationships and Stop & Start, decal 0-100 in 11.9 seconds and reduces two seconds recoveries of 80-120 km / h. Its average consumption is 3.9 liters per 100
Above the 1.6 CDTi will be located 136 horses, which is even more efficient, with an average consumption of 3.8 liters per 100 and emissions of 99 grams of CO2 per kilometer. It will be the replacement for the 2.0 CDTi 140 hp and top speed while going from 205 to 210 km / h at 0-100 is four tenths slower , stopping the clock 10.9 seconds, which is a very modest figure.
In terms of infotainment Opel Insignia also offers news, technology OnStar eCall and technical assistance as well as the ability to create a WiFi hotspot that lets you connect up to seven devices to the vehicle. The multimedia system Navi 900 IntelliLink also incorporate Apple carplay , allowing iOS smartphones integrate after the iPhone 5 and use many of their functions integrated into the vehicle.
